Selling your home simply because the market is H O T could be the only reason you are ready to make a move. But before you do, consider the following:
1. How long have you been in your house? Has it been long enough to build equity? How much do you owe?
2. Is everyone in your household mentally prepared for the move?
3. Is the house ready to put on the market? Are there any repairs or replacements to consider? What amount of money will it take to get the house show-ready? How long will it take for the house to be ready?
4. How realistic is the dollar amount you want to list the house for?
5. Do you plan to buy another house or lease? What are your credit scores? Do you have the necessary funds for a down payment? Perhaps you plan to buy cash, will you have funds for taxes and possible repairs or upgrades?
6. Would it be okay to move across town or remain nearby?
And the list goes on. There are other things to consider before making the move. However, if your house is located in a desirable area with a great floor plan and in mint condition, and you are okay to Lease until you find the perfect one, then you may be in a position to sell.
